Couple killed as car hits bike

Mandya: The family members of a couple, who were killed in a road accident between Keregodu village and Marilinganadoddi in the taluk, gave their consent to donate the organs, thus displaying their humanitarian concern even in grief.

The deceased are C. Manju (46) and his wife H.S. Suneela (40), residents of Chikkabanasawadi near Keregodu village. While Suneela was killed on the spot in the accident that took place on Wednesday, Manju, who had sustained serious injuries and admitted to a private hospital in Bengaluru, succumbed to injuries yesterday.

On Wednesday, the couple were proceeding to a temple at Keregodu village on their bike when a car rammed into their  bike from behind near Marilinganadoddi, killing Suneela on the spot and seriously injuring Manju.

Manju was rushed to Mandya District Hospital, where he was provided first-aid and was later shifted to a private hospital in Bengaluru, where he breathed his last yesterday afternoon.

The doctors, who announced the death of Manju to the family members, counselled them about the importance of organ donation following which the family members gave their consent to donate the organs of Manju.

A case has been registered at Keregodu Police Station.
